316L Stainless Steel Foil – Lab Research-Grade Cathode Current Collector for Aqueous Zinc-Ion Batteries
316L stainless steel foil serves as the positive current collector for aqueous zinc-ion batteries, offering excellent electrical conductivity and stability. Its surface forms a protective passivation film that prevents corrosion while maintaining superior processability, formability, and weldability.

Technical Parameters
Indicator Name Value
Tensile Strength σb (MPa) ≥480
Conditional Yield Strength σ0.2 (MPa) ≥177
Elongation δ5 (%) ≥40
Reduction of Area ψ (%) ≥60
Hardness ≤187HB; ≤90HRB; ≤200HV
Density 7.98g/cm³
Specific Heat Ratio (20℃) 0.502J/(g·K)
